Plymouth vs. UW-Platteville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Plymouth or UW-Platteville?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Wisconsin Platteville than Plymouth ($16,266 vs. $20,183).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Wisconsin Platteville are 24.9% lower than at Plymouth State University ($9,886 vs. $13,158).
- Plymouth State University is 69.2% more expensive for in-state tuition than UW-Platteville (about $5,982 more per year; $14,626.00 vs. $8,644.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 45.2% higher at Plymouth than at University of Wisconsin Platteville (about $7,963 more per year; $25,566.00 vs. $17,603.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Plymouth State University than at University of Wisconsin Platteville (100% vs. 78%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Plymouth State University students is 130.9% larger than aid received by University of Wisconsin Platteville students ($11,039 vs. $4,780).

Plymouth vs. UW-Platteville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Plymouth and UW-Platteville?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Plymouth State University's six-year graduation rate (59%) is higher than University of Wisconsin Platteville's (52%).
- Graduates from University of Wisconsin Platteville earn a median of about $7,400 more per year than Plymouth graduates about ten years after starting college ($49,600 vs. $42,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, University of Wisconsin Platteville graduates have a $2,745 lower median loan debt than Plymouth graduates ($24,255 vs. $27,000).
- Among borrowers, UW-Platteville graduates have an estimated $29 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Plymouth graduates ($250 vs. $279).
- More UW-Platteville gra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Plymouth students, three years after graduation. (78% vs. 73%)
